Ticket: Staging env misconfigured for Siftgate bloom filter

The bloom layer in front of the Pellet KV store is rejecting all lookups in staging because the env file was copied from the dev template without credentials. False-positive tuning values are fine; only the auth line is missing. To unblock the weekly demo, the Pellet admission secret must be set on the following line.

env line for yaguf-fajop: LEDGER_TOKEN13=fb08984397349

**Mgmt Meeting Minutes — Retiring the Brightline Range**

Quick recap for sales leads at Fenholt Supplies: we agreed to retire the Brightline fixture range by year-end. Remaining stock moves to clearance pricing next month, and accounts on standing orders get migrated to the Lumetta range. Trade-in incentives were approved in principle. The confidential note on next steps sits just below.

board note of bajof-bajeg: The pricing group signed off on a budget of $13.4 million for Project Sildor. The renewal with Lamixek Holdings closes at $48.9 million a year, 49 percent above the last contract.

### Action Item: Spoolhaven Retry Storm

From last Tuesday's outage: the Spoolhaven print service retried failed jobs without backoff, saturating the render pool. Fix merged; retries now use capped exponential backoff with jitter. Owner will monitor for a week before closing. The agreed retry constants are recorded below.

constants for yadup-kajof:
RATE_LIMITS = {
    "zorwyn": 1,
    "druwyn": 1,
}